XmlTextReader.Encoding Właściwość
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Pobiera kodowanie dokumentu.
public:
property System::Text::Encoding ^ Encoding { System::Text::Encoding ^ get(); };
public System.Text.Encoding? Encoding { get; }
public System.Text.Encoding Encoding { get; }
member this.Encoding : System.Text.Encoding
Public ReadOnly Property Encoding As Encoding
Wartość właściwości
Wartość kodowania. Jeśli atrybut kodowania nie istnieje i nie ma żadnego znacznika kolejności bajtów, wartość domyślna to UTF-8.
Uwagi
Uwaga
Począwszy od .NET Framework 2.0, zalecamy utworzenie XmlReader wystąpień przy użyciu XmlReader.Create metody , aby korzystać z nowych funkcji.
Ponieważ XmlTextReader używa System.Text.Encoding klasy , XmlTextReader
obsługuje również wszystkie kodowanie obsługiwane przez tę klasę. Wyjątkiem od tego jest każde kodowanie, takie jak UTF-7 lub EBCDIC, które mapuje <?xml
sekwencję na różne wartości bajtów niż UTF-8.